Bamboo Tai Briefs – The Classic Explained

Short answer: The tai brief is the classic style of brief with a high leg cut and a normal waist that many women have worn all their lives. In bamboo viscose the classic gains a softness and breathability that make it even more comfortable as an everyday brief.

What characterises a tai brief?

The tai has a high, angled leg cut that visually lengthens the leg, and a waist that is neither high nor low. It gives good coverage without using much fabric and is one of the most widespread styles of all. See the range of bamboo briefs.

Frequently asked questions

What is a tai brief?

A classic style of brief with a high leg cut and a normal waist. It gives good coverage with a simple and timeless cut.

Who does the tai brief suit?

Most people. It is a versatile everyday style that sits well under almost anything and does not feel tight either high or low.
